lineage

/ˈlɪn.i.ɪdʒ/

Example:

His noble lineage could be traced back to ancient kings.

blended family

/ˈblen.dɪd ˌfæm.ɪ.li/

Example:

They formed a happy blended family after their remarriage.

blue blood

/ˈbluː blʌd/

Example:

Despite his humble beginnings, he married into a family of blue blood.

broken home

/ˈbroʊkən hoʊm/

Example:

Growing up in a broken home can present unique challenges for children.

consanguinity

/ˌkɑːn.sæŋˈɡwɪn.ə.t̬i/

Example:

The legal system often considers consanguinity in matters of inheritance.

pedigree

/ˈped.ə.ɡriː/

Example:

The dog has an excellent pedigree, with champions in its lineage.

progeny

/ˈprɑː.dʒə.ni/

Example:

The old farmer was proud of his numerous progeny.

surrogate mother

/ˈsɝː.ə.ɡeɪt ˌmʌð.ər/

Example:

The couple decided to use a surrogate mother to have a child.

progenitor

/proʊˈdʒen.ə.t̬ɚ/

Example:

The first single-celled organisms were the progenitors of all life on Earth.
